- Phoenix-based artist Ben Willis has taken over Fort Worth art gallery Fort Works Art. Head there to see his solo show inspired by a childhood favorite game – “Candy Man.” And Willis’ curated show “Candy Castle,” continues the whimsy and color with works from national artists.
- In Dallas, The Geometric and MADI Museum hosts a juried competition recognizing visual artists inspired by geometric abstraction. Geometric MADI Biennial: Origins in Geometry is on view through October 22.
- In Denton, learn about the 125-year-old history of the North Texas State Fair and Rodeo. It’s part of the Courthouse-on-the-Square free lecture series continuing Denton County’s look back at history.
